重慶分公司,新征程啟航
為企業(yè)提供網(wǎng)站建設(shè)、域名注冊、服務(wù)器等服務(wù)
為企業(yè)提供網(wǎng)站建設(shè)、域名注冊、服務(wù)器等服務(wù)
最近在學(xué)習(xí)Vue,今天正好寫個學(xué)習(xí)筆記,把以前遇到的錯誤給總結(jié)一下。
Vue目前的的開發(fā)模式主要有兩種:
1.直接頁面級的開發(fā),script直接引入Vue
2.工程性開發(fā),webpack+loader或者直接使用腳手架工具Vue-cli,里面的文件都配置好了
webpack可以進(jìn)行配置,配置多文件入口,進(jìn)行多頁面開發(fā)
第二種Vue開發(fā),結(jié)合webpack打包完文件會很大,怎么解決這個問題?
1.webpack代碼拆分:code-spliting
2.提取公共(如提取css,js)
3.預(yù)渲染:使用prerender-spa-plugin插件
4.后臺————開啟壓縮,gzip (會很有用)
5.異步加載組件:require.ensure
Vue常見錯誤解決方法:
1.[Vue-warn]: Missing required prop: "to" (found in component
這個錯誤是
并且路由在做字符串拼接的時候,to要作為一個屬性綁定
2.端口沖突錯誤:需要改端口
當(dāng)然現(xiàn)在vue2.0中的webpack 已經(jīng)自己會根據(jù)你的端口號進(jìn)行改正,從8080往后面進(jìn)行遞增,不會發(fā)生端口號沖突的情況,在vue1.0中會經(jīng)常出現(xiàn)
3.[Vue-warn]:Unknown custom element:
錯誤1:引進(jìn)來的vue-router沒有use()
import Vue from 'vue' import VueRouter from 'vue-router' Vue.use(VueRouter);
另外有需要云服務(wù)器可以了解下創(chuàng)新互聯(lián)建站www.cdcxhl.com,海內(nèi)外云服務(wù)器15元起步,三天無理由+7*72小時售后在線,公司持有idc許可證,提供“云服務(wù)器、裸金屬服務(wù)器、高防服務(wù)器、香港服務(wù)器、美國服務(wù)器、虛擬主機、免備案服務(wù)器”等云主機租用服務(wù)以及企業(yè)上云的綜合解決方案,具有“安全穩(wěn)定、簡單易用、服務(wù)可用性高、性價比高”等特點與優(yōu)勢,專為企業(yè)上云打造定制,能夠滿足用戶豐富、多元化的應(yīng)用場景需求。